Stenography Machines Advancement



As innovation advancements, stenography makers have evolved significantly, enhancing the method court reporters catch talked words. You'll notice modern-day devices are currently a lot more portable and easy to use, permitting higher portability and convenience of usage. These tools use multiple keys that allow you to kind whole phrases simultaneously, significantly boosting transcription speed and accuracy. With integrated memory, they can store extensive vocabulary, adjusting to different lawful contexts. Furthermore, innovations in software have actually improved the assimilation of these machines with electronic devices, even more improving the transcription process. Therefore, you can count on these advanced makers to provide specific and timely transcripts, ensuring justice is offered properly in every court setting.

Difficulties Encountered by Court Reporters



The stability of test documents depends greatly on the abilities of court reporters, however they face Find Out More many challenges that can affect their job. One significant hurdle is the busy nature of lawful proceedings.


Additionally, differing accents and speaking designs can position difficulties in understanding and transcribing properly. You might likewise come across psychological testaments that call for a high level of concentration and compassion, which can be draining.


Furthermore, tight due dates frequently imply you're working under pressure, leaving little room for mistake. These obstacles highlight the value of your role and the need for continuous training and support to preserve the quality and precision of court reporting in the justice system.

What Is the Typical Wage of a Court Reporter?





The ordinary wage of a court press reporter differs, however it usually ranges from $50,000 to $80,000 yearly. Elements like location, experience, and field of expertise can substantially affect your earning potential in this occupation.
